Huge QoL upgrade vs. a big corded vaccum. Cleans carpet very well.
My home has never been cleaner, becuase vaccuming is now an easy, quick chore, vs. something I need to plan around. This is my first fullsize cordless vaccum, having spent the last 15+ years with top quality, but heavy, inconvienent corded vaccums.We have 2 dogs that will bless our house with their fur in every rug, carpert and hard surface corner of every space, so I was always convinced I needed some big, powerful vaccum. I purchsed the Jet 75 more as a quick, secondary handheld, but it has quicly replaced my corded vaccum for every purpose, including full room carpet & rug. It does an excellent job getting dog fur out of carpet. The carpet extension is powerful and grabby for the fur. It pulls up matted carpet and makes it stand as well as my big (expesive) corded vaccum.On the high setting, it's powerful enough to suck up the tracked in dirt, grass, pebbles, cereal and dry spills of the house. It is super easy to dump out and suprisingly easy to clean the internal components when they eventully get caked with dust. The low power mode isn't enough power, unless you're just hitting the super light clumps of fur collected in corners of the room.Battery life is just okay. I purchased a bundle that came with 2 batteries, and I need both to get the house cleaned top to bottom. On the high setting you'll get maybe 10-12min per battery. The catch bin is a bit small. I think I empty it 3 or 4 times per full house cleaning, but the process is super quick. The compoenents attach and detach super easy, but I'm not crazy about the brush attachment. The bristles are too long, and far enough away from the airflow that I can often just push the debris around vs. sucking it up with that attachment.Overall, this has been an A-, maybe a full A, for me. It's not without it's comprimises, but it exceeded my orignal expectations by a mile to become my full time vaccume.

Very Good Package
First off, I was able to purchase this Jet 75 Bundle through some miracle for $180 a couple weeks ago right here on Amazon.My house is mostly hardwood or LVP flooring with area rugs and some carpeted bedrooms. I have a heavy shedding dog and three cats. The dog sheds clumps of long hair. Once I assembled everything and the batteries were charged, I went to work. Suction power was very impressive, removing clumps of dog hair with little issue. The beater bar works okay on wood floors for small debris.The dust bin is small requiring very frequent dumps. The included dumping receptacle was fantastic and was a nice surprise as it wasn't really a selling feature for me. It cleaned the dust bin out spotless every time with no dust getting anywhere.This seems to be marketed as a whole house vacuum and while I will absolutely use it for that, It just seems small and certainly not as powerful as my plug in vacuums. However, its so easy to use even my kids are enjoying using it and my 6 year old has no problem vacuuming her room now.Batteries take awhile to charge but that's not been an issue. I have no problems vacuuming what I need to vacuum with the amount of life the batteries provide. The included accessories are great and I do not find myself wishing for different ones.The only negative thing I have to say about it is that it will not stand on its own. You have to lean it on something and that is incredibly annoying. I will also mention that it would be nice if you didnt need to remove the dust bin from the vacuum to clean it out with the receptacle. Seems like a useless extra step from a design standpoint.Finally, I think I would have been a bit disappointed paying over $400 for this. While it is a great vacuum, I think its value proposition is pretty diluted at that price point.
